What are the goals of the ETIAS Visa?

Increasing security, minimizing application processes, strengthening the protection of European Union borders and lowering crime and terrorism is what ETIAS seeks to so. These have been the primary goals of the heads of EU states.

The ETIAS application will only take you 10 minutes to fill out and will have questions regarding the most basic information about you (name, address, citizenship, etc.).

Individuals under 18 years old can’t apply. Their legal guardian must apply for them instead.

What are the steps you need to take for the ETIAS Visa?

Firstly, you have to pay the application fee of 7 Euros to apply for an ETIAS. You will have your answer within minutes if this application is approved by the system.

Do you need to take the ETIAS authorization with you when you travel?

The answer to that is yes. Also, if you are authorized an ETIAS, it will be valid for three years or until the expiry date of your passport. If you are not given authorization you will also get an answer with the reasons why.
